'Blinky the Clown' laid to rest Tuesday

DENVER - Russell Scott, better known as Blinky the Clown, will be laid to rest Tuesday.

Scott starred in the Denver television classic "Blinky's Fun Club" for 40 years. The show was canceled in 1998.

His funeral service is open to the public and starts at 10 a.m. Tuesday morning at the Denver Consistory Theatre at the Scottish Rite Center.

He passed away last week after complications from pneumonia. He was 91.

Following the services, Scott will be laid to rest at Fort Logan National Cemetery with full military honors.

In lieu of flowers, the family requests contributions be made in honor of Blinky to Shriners Burn Hospitals.
